body{
	font:75% Tahoma, sans-serif; 
	 text-align:center;	
}
#wrapper{
         width:400px;
		 margin:0 auto;
		 margin-top:200px;
		text-align:left;	
         }
.cornerstop{ background :url("../image/sprite5_blue.gif") no-repeat -16px 0;
             margin:0 8px;
           }
.cornerstop div{height:16px;
              background:url("../image/sprite5_blue.gif") no-repeat -400px 0;
               }
.forshadow{
           background:url("../image/sprite5_blue.gif") repeat-y -797px 0;
           }
.forshadow2{background:url("../image/sprite5_blue.gif") repeat-y -908px 0;
            padding:0 30px 20px 30px;
           }
#headerblock{padding-top:16px;
 			 height:52px;
			
             }
#logoblock{width:137px;
		   float:left;
		   margin-left:-2px;
           }

#logoblock div{padding-left:3px;
		   font-weight: bold;
              }

#rproxyinfo{
    padding-bottom: 10px;
    display: none;
}

#rproxyinfo a {
    color: #007CBA;
    cursor: pointer;
}

#id_div_container_login_input span{display:block;
                                  font-weight:bold;
								  margin-bottom:3px;
                              }
#A1, #A2{width:335px;
         margin-bottom:15px;
          }
.remb{margin:0;
      float:left;
      }
#id_div_container_login_input .remember{padding-left:17px;
          font-weight:normal;
          }
		  
#id_div_container_buttons{margin-top:25px;
                     }
.cornersbottom{background :url("../image/sprite5_blue.gif") no-repeat -1713px 0;
 
               }
.cornersbottom div{height:16px;
                 background :url("../image/sprite5_blue.gif") no-repeat -2137px 0;
                  }
